The captives of abb's valley - cdthis cd contains both the 1854 edition and the 1942 edition. This is the story of the captain james moore family in their capture, massacre and escape from the shawnee.
The captives of abb's valley: a legend of frontier life provides other interesting information besides the capture and ransom story. Brown states that abb's valley was named for absalom looney, who was supposedly the first white man to visit it, in about 1766.

Born in rockbridge, virginia, usa on 1799 to samuel brown and mary moore (one of the captives of abb’s valley), james moore brown married mary ann bell and had 6 children. His only book, the captives of abb’s valley was first published in 1854.
